欢迎访问网科手机

iphone游戏用什么开发

频道:手机价格 日期: 浏览:10

📱【iPhone游戏开发全解析】揭秘最适合iPhone游戏的开发工具!

随着智能手机的普及,iPhone游戏市场日益繁荣,众多开发者纷纷投身于iPhone游戏开发的大潮中,力求在这片蓝海中分得一杯羹,iPhone游戏用什么开发呢?下面就来为大家揭秘!

我们要明确的是,iPhone游戏开发主要分为两大类:原生开发和非原生开发。

原生开发

原生开发指的是使用Objective-C或Swift语言,在Xcode开发环境中进行游戏开发,这种方法具有以下优势:

  • 性能优越:原生开发的游戏运行流畅,画面精美,性能稳定。
  • 体验极佳:原生游戏与iOS系统高度兼容,操作体验极佳。
  • 更新便捷:原生游戏可以直接在App Store上更新,无需额外操作。

原生开发有哪些常用工具呢?

  • Xcode:苹果官方的开发工具,支持Objective-C和Swift两种编程语言。
  • Interface Builder:用于设计UI界面,简化开发过程。
  • Scene Kit:用于创建3D游戏,提供丰富的3D图形渲染功能。

非原生开发

非原生开发指的是使用跨平台开发工具,如Unity、Cocos2d-x等,实现iPhone游戏开发,这种方法具有以下优势:

  • 跨平台:一次开发,即可适配多个平台,节省时间和成本。
  • 开发周期短:非原生开发工具提供了丰富的资源和插件,缩短了开发周期。
  • 适应性强:非原生开发工具可以根据不同平台的特点进行优化,满足不同需求。

以下是几种常见的非原生开发工具:

  • Unity:一款功能强大的游戏开发引擎,支持2D和3D游戏开发。
  • Cocos2d-x:一款开源的游戏开发框架,拥有丰富的社区资源。
  • Unreal Engine:一款高端的游戏开发引擎,适合开发高品质游戏。

iPhone游戏开发有多种方法,开发者可以根据自己的需求和喜好选择合适的开发工具,无论是原生开发还是非原生开发,都要注重游戏质量,为用户提供优质的游戏体验。🎮🎮🎮

希望本文对您有所帮助,祝您在iPhone游戏开发的道路上一帆风顺!🌟🌟🌟